How to decrypt message with CryptoJS AES. I have a working Ruby example

后端 未结 5 2028
萌比男神i
萌比男神i 2020-12-01 01:57

I\'m able to decrypt AES encrypted message with Ruby like this:

require \'openssl\'
require \'base64\'

data = \"IYkyGxYaNgHpnZWgwILMalVFmLWFgTCHCZL9263NOcfS         


        
5条回答
  •  南笙
    南笙 (楼主)
    2020-12-01 02:08

        var key = CryptoJS.enc.Utf8.parse('8080808080808080');
        var iv = CryptoJS.enc.Utf8.parse('8080808080808080');
        var _enid = CryptoJS.AES.decrypt(data, key,
      {
          keySize: 128 / 8,
          iv: iv,
          mode: CryptoJS.mode.CBC,
          padding: CryptoJS.pad.Pkcs7
      }).toString(CryptoJS.enc.Utf8);
        return _enid;
    

提交回复
热议问题